The repetitive exposure to noxious stimuli triggers an action likely to generally be propagated into the central terminal by way of the sensory neurons, and also towards the peripheral terminal by using the collateral axon branches, which subsequently triggers the membrane depolarization together with Ca2+ influx by means of the VOCC, which consequently induces the transmitters to be unveiled at the internet site in the injury and activates the surrounding nociceptors. This process is known as sensitization. Sensitization is described as the reduce in threshold to stimulation, in addition to an increase of firing amount on account of the enhanced sensitivity of primary afferent nociceptors. Actually, this Increased and prolonged response to the stimuli is often manifested as Key hyperalgesia. The summation in the launched intracellular contents, including ATP, bradykinin (BK), five-HT, NE, PGE2, NGF and SP at the positioning of the ruined cells or inflammatory cells, is also called inflammatory soup.

The involvement of H4 receptors in both of those acute (Galeotti, Sanna, & Ghelardini, 2013) and persistent inflammatory pain (Hsieh et al., 2010) is pretty effectively documented, and not too long ago, the function of H4 receptors while in the modulation of neuropathic pain was determined in H4 receptor‐KO mice through the Block Pain Receptors with Proleviate observation that these animals, when subjected to neuropathic pain, induced by spared nerve damage of sciatic nerve, showed Improved hypersensitivity to mechanical and thermal stimuli in comparison with wild‐kind controls (Sanna, Ghelardini, et al., 2017). Apparently, H4 receptor deficiency would not support a job for H4 receptors within the physiological maintenance of pain threshold, as H4 receptor‐KO mice did not show any modify in thermal or mechanical nociceptive thresholds, suggesting that the H4 receptor is particularly associated with the regulation of hypersensitivity linked with pathological Continual pain induced by nerve personal injury (Sanna, Ghelardini, et al., 2017). This observation in H4 receptor‐KO neuropathic mice is particularly essential as H4 receptor mRNA expression in humans and rodents supports their involvement in the regulation of neuronal function, which include regulation of neuropathic pain.
